DeeDi - трезвые записки

queue(func)

Добавляет новую функцию, которая долна быть выполнена, в конец очереди для всех элементов набора.

В примере ставим в очередь пользовательскую фукцию (она в конце закрашивает на кубик красным цветом):

 $(document).ready(function() {
function run_anim() { $("#example_data button").click(function () { $("#example_data div").show("slow"); $("#example_data div").animate({width: '60'}); $("#example_data div").animate({marginLeft: '400'}, 2000); $("#example_data div").fadeTo(1000, 0.2); $("#example_data div").fadeTo(1000, 1); $("#example_data div").animate({width: '30'}); $("#example_data div").animate({marginLeft: '0'}, 2000); $("#example_data div").queue(function () { $(this).css("background", "red"); });});
HTML:
<div id="example_data">
<div></div><br />
<button>запустить</button>
<span></span>
</div>

Боковой текст: